Marco Butti penalised for incident with Mikel Azcona

Honda driver Marco Butti has been hit with a penalty for an incident with Mikel Azcona during the first FIA TCR World Tour race of 2024 at Vallelunga in Italy.

The GOAT Racing driver made contact with Azcona at Turn 7 on the first lap, climbing to fourth position.

The stewards handed Butti a five-second penalty for the incident, dropping him behind Azcona to fifth position in the results.

Butti also received one penalty point for the incident.

Volcano Motorsport driver Sami Taoufik, who retired from the race, was handed a three-place grid penalty for the next race as he left his pit allocation in an incorrect order during the Q1 qualifying session.

Taoufik was supposed to start Race 2 from 12th position and is now demoted to 15th.
